#338550 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#338550 is composed of 20% red, 52.2%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 39.8% yellow and 47.8% black. It has a hue angle of 141.2 degrees, a saturation of 44.6% and a lightness of 36.1%. #338550 color hex could be obtained by blending #66ffa0 with #000b00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#338550 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#338550 has RGB values of R:51, G:133,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.62, M:0, Y:0.4, K:0.48. Its decimal value is 3376464.
